Frequently Asked Questions

What is the population and demographic makeup of Texhoma?

The total population of Texhoma is approximately 1,034. The largest age group is 35-64 year olds. This demographic data is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au.

Is Texhoma walkable and transit-friendly?

Based on local geographic data, Texhoma has an amenity and walkability score of 36/100 and a transit score of 77/100. This indicates the area is mostly car-dependent for daily errands and commuting.

Do more people rent or own homes in Texhoma?

The housing market in Texhoma is predominantly driven by homeowners, with 83% of housing units being owner-occupied and 17% being renter-occupied.

What is the education level of residents in Texhoma?

In Texhoma, approximately 25% of adult resid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. Additionally, 4% of the population holds a master's degree or higher. This indicates the local educational attainment compared to state and national averages.
